Sonia Denis Joins Disney+ Series ‘Ironheart’

Variety reports that Sonia Denis has been cast in an undisclosed role in Ironheart, the newest Marvel Studios television series on Disney+. Denis also worked on Guilty Party for Paramount+ and most recently received an Emmy nomination for his efforts on the HBO show A Black Lady Sketch Show’s writing staff.

The protagonist of the six-episode series is Dominique Thorne’s portrayal of Riri Williams. Riri, a genius engineering student at the Massachusetts Institute of Technology, is 15 years old. Williams creates a suit of armour modelled after Iron Man’s, as created by Tony Stark, and adopts the moniker Ironheart. Black Panther: Wakanda Forever, which opens in theatres in November, will be the first movie to feature Williams, who made his or her debut in the teaser only recently. Of the D23 Expo in California in September, a first look at Ironheart was also shown.

Along with Lyric Ross, Anthony Ramos, Alden Ehrenreich, Manny Montana, and Denis. Ross will play Williams’ best friend, and Ramos will play the show’s antagonist, The Hood. The D23 footage did show Ramos’ character telling Williams that she might be forced to do bad things for a good cause before finding a red hood and displaying some magical abilities. However, there are currently few plot details available.

Williams’ inventive skills were showcased in the most recent Wakanda Forever trailer, in which she assembled her iron armour and joyously took flight while wearing it. The character is shown smashing the suit in earlier trailers, in a very obvious homage to Robert Downey Jr.’s iconic sequence from the first Iron Man movie, which began the Marvel Cinematic Universe back in 2008. The show is establishing the protagonist to be Iron Man’s spiritual heir.
